Sorry, there was a problem. Please try again later.This model is intended for residential use. The limited warranty that accompanies our appliances does not cover the failure of the product if it is used commercially. Examples of commercial use include microwave units used in restaurants, employee cafeterias, or any other general food preparation applications.
